Traffic Restrictions On Highway 29 At Muscogee And I-10

April 2, 2012

There will be traffic delays in two different areas along Highway 29 overnight Tuesday through Thursday.

Southbound traffic on U.S. 29 at Muscogee Road and at the I-10 overpass in Escambia County will encounter overnight lane restrictions Tuesday through Thursday between 8 p.m. and 4 a.m. as Transfield Services performs routine maintenance.

Drivers are reminded to pay attention to the speed limit when traveling through the construction area, and to use caution, especially at night when driving in work zones, according to the Florida Department of Transporation.

Property Taxes Are Now Late, But There’s A Reprieve

April 2, 2012

Real estate and tangible personal property taxes became delinquent on Sunday, but there’s a little reprieve if you forgot to pay up on time.

Since the March 31 deadline fell during a weekend when the tax collector officers were closed, offices will still accept payments without penalty on Monday, April 2 for in person payments only.

If not paid by today in person, a penalty of 3 percent for real estate and 1½ percent for tangible taxes will be assessed. At last report, over $32.5 million (approximately 13%) of the Escambia County tax roll remains unpaid, according to Tax Collector Janet Holley.

Police Investigate Attempted Kidnapping Of Child Walking To School

March 31, 2012

Police are investing an attempted kidnapping as a child walked to an elementary school in Escambia County Friday morning. It happened in Pensacola, but parents everywhere are being urged to take steps to make sure their children are safe.

The child was walking to Scenic Heights Elementary when she said she was approached by a man in a green minivan who tried to give her a ride and offered her candy and toys. He then allegedly pulled out a long knife, prompting her to run away, according to police.

The suspect was described as a black male, about 35-45 years old with a diamond earring, curly black hair and a beard on his chin.

According to Pensacola Police, another child at the school admitted Friday that a similar incident had happened to her, with the man trying to lure the girl into his apartment.

According to school officials, parents can share these safety ideas with their child:

  • Trust your feelings, if someone makes you uncomfortable, get away and tell your parents or a trusted adult.
  • Walk with a parent, friend or group.
  • Walk on main streets.
  • If someone offers you a ride, say no.
  • If someone offers to take you somewhere, run away and yell.
  • If you go home alone after school, call your parents and let them know you are OK when you arrive home.

      Northview Music Program To Hold 10 Hours Music Marathon

      March 29, 2012

      The Northview High School band and fine arts music programs will hold a 10 hour music marathon on Saturday.

      It is the Fine Arts Department’s fund raiser for a spring trip to Atlanta. The students are looking for sponsors by the hour; for 10 straight hours, some sort of music will be happening at all times.

      “We’ll use part of the time for rehearsal and part of the time for fun music activities and games,” program director Elaine Holk said.
